Hamburg's harbor is one of Europe's most dynamic waterfronts, where centuries-old maritime heritage meets cutting-edge innovation. Stroll through the HafenCity district to witness stunning contemporary architecture rise alongside historic warehouses, or explore the charming cobblestone streets of the Speicherstadt with its iconic red-brick buildings. The harbor itself buzzes with energy as massive container ships share the waterway with elegant sailboats and historic paddle steamers, creating an ever-changing backdrop for your wandering. Spring and early autumn offer the perfect climate to experience Hamburg at its best, when mild weather makes harbor walks and canal boat tours genuinely memorable. The waterfront comes alive with weekend markets, open-air restaurants, and cultural events that capture the city's progressive spirit. Whether you're sipping coffee at a harborside café, visiting world-class museums, or simply soaking in the salty breeze, Hamburg's harbor delivers an intoxicating blend of working port atmosphere and cosmopolitan charm that keeps travelers coming back.
